Types of Mental Health Providers in Berkey, OH

A mental health disorder can manifest itself in a number of ways, (negative or irrational thoughts, physical ailments, problematic behaviors) and the intensity can range from mild to severe. As such, there are multiple types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.

Psychologists in Berkey

A psychologist is a mental health professional who is qualified to conduct psychological evaluations and provide diagnoses. These individuals are also trained in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. Much of their practice revolves around ident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.

Psychiatrists in Berkey

Sometimes there is a need for more immediate or intense treatment compared to what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Even though, they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.

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Berkey

All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als who have completed a master degree in fields such as psychology, marriage and family therapy, or other specialties. They function more like psychologists than psychiatrists, being treatment-focused often with an emphasis on modifying behavior. More often than not, behavioral therapy is the primary mode of treatment offered.

Paying for Berkey Mental Health Rehab

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is an overview of all of the ways to pay for mental health treatment:

  •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. You can also sign up for your own private insurance plan directly through a private insurance provider.
  • Subsidized Private Insurance is available through the Healthcare Marketplace to those who earn less than a certain income, but also do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
  •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
  •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
  • Out-of-pocket]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health rehab Berkey out-of-pocket. People who can self-pay - but not all at once - may ask about a payment plan or line of credit.
  • Scholarships - Certain mental health rehab programs Berkey offer scholarship opportunities for people who display a tremendous desire and dedication to getting better, but otherwise would not have the therapy.
  • “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health services to their local community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with a great demand for these services.
